ZHCUBF5A October   2023  – February 2024 TPS38700 , TPS389006

 

  1.   1
  2.   说明
  3.   开始使用
  4.   特性
  5.   应用
  6.   6
  7. 1评估模块概述
    1. 1.1 引言
    2. 1.2 套件内容
    3. 1.3 规格
    4. 1.4 器件信息
    5. 1.5 同步功能
  8. 2硬件
    1. 2.1 设置
    2. 2.2 连接器、接头和 LED
    3. 2.3 EVM 跳线
  9. 3软件
    1. 3.1 软件说明
  10. 4TPS389387EVM 评估说明
  11. 5TPS38700-Q1 GUI 说明
    1. 5.1 GUI 安装
    2. 5.2 TPS38700-Q1 GUI 快速入门
    3. 5.3 GUI
  12. 6硬件设计文件
    1. 6.1 原理图
    2. 6.2 PCB 布局
    3. 6.3 物料清单
  13. 7其他信息
    1. 7.1 相关文档
    2.     商标
  14. 8修订历史记录

TPS389387EVM 评估说明

所需设备

TPS389387EVM 评估所需的硬件设备:

  • TPS389387EVM
  • MSP430 LaunchPad™,MSP-EXP430FR2355

  • MSP430 连接器/电源线(USB 转 micro-USB)
  • 多通道示波器,用于检查评估波形
  • 跳线电缆,用于附加评估

TPS389387EVM 评估所需的软件:

  • 一个包含用于控制 TPS389387EVM 的可编辑代码的 zip 文件。可以在此处下载该文件。
  • Code Composer Studio IDE (CCS),CCS v8.0 或更高版本。Code Composer Studio Desktop 是一种专业的集成开发环境,支持 TI 的微控制器和嵌入式处理器米6体育平台手机版_好二三四组合。Code Composer Studio 包含一整套用于开发和调试嵌入式应用的工具。Code Composer Studio 包含用于优化的 C/C++ 编译器、源代码编辑器、工程构建环境、调试器、性能分析器以及很多其他功能。请访问 Code Composer Studio 了解有关 CCS 的更多信息并下载该工具。

硬件设置

请按照以下步骤进行硬件设置:

  1. 将 MSP430 连接到 TPS389387EVM 底部的引脚。包含 MSP430 的 TPS389387EVM 电路板底部中详细说明了方向。确保 GND 引脚与相应的板连接器相匹配。
  2. 将电源线连接到 MSP430 和计算机的 USB 端口。
  3. 确保根据表 3-2 中的指南连接了所有跳线。

软件设置

  1. 下载 Code Composer Studio IDE (CCS) 以编辑该 EVM 的代码。
    1. 有一个云编辑器可供使用,但这不是必需的。
    2. CCS 可能会询问是否需要其他元件。请选择 MSP430 选项,然后再继续下载。
  2. 下载评估 EVM 所需的代码。
  3. 启动 CCS 并将代码导入工作区。请参阅 ti.com 上的 CCS 入门说明以获得更多帮助。
    1. 启动 CCS 后,选择一个工作区目录。这将确定您的工程在操作系统上的位置。
    2. 使用“Project”>“Import Existing CCS Eclipse Project”。转到包含 main.c 的所需演示工程目录。图 5-1 对此进行了说明。
      GUID-20230823-SS0I-ZCL8-1T9S-KLLH98HXZJVS-low.png图 4-1 在 CCS 中选择工程目录
    3. 点击 OK
    4. CCS 识别该工程并允许用户导入。通过查找工程名称左侧的复选标记来进行检查,以确保 CCS 已找到该工程。如图 5-2 中所示。
      GUID-20230823-SS0I-GGQW-R65X-DL771MPQ3X76-low.png图 4-2 在 CCS 中识别该工程
    5. 如果 CCS 未显示复选标记,那么这意味着您的工作区已有一个同名的工程。可以通过重命名或删除该工程来解决此问题。
    6. 此时,代码已全部上传至 CCS 中。工作区如图 5-1 所示。
    GUID-20230823-SS0I-RFLF-95VL-KHPVG733TXQB-low.png图 4-3 已上传代码的 CCS 工作区
  4. 编辑代码以确认操作正确。
    1. 要更改虚拟电源树的输出电压,请编辑第 8 行。该行内容如下:

      const float outputVoltages[] = {1600,1600,1600,1600,1600,1600,3000,2500,2500,2500,2500,2500};

      括号中的每个值都对应于 TPS389006 功率监测器轨的输出电压。这些值均以毫伏为单位。

    2. 要更改每个虚拟电源轨是否需要来自序列发生器的使能信号才能启动,请编辑第 13 行。该行内容如下:

      const int requiresEN = 0;

      如果“=”后面的值是 0,则不需要来自序列发生器的使能信号。如果该值设置为 1,则需要来自序列发生器的使能信号才能启动。

  5. 通过在 CCS 工作区中选择 Run > Start Debugging 来运行代码。有关更多信息,请参阅图 5-4
    GUID-20230823-SS0I-9VWL-WVMM-CLWPJTDCXT3V-low.png图 4-4 在 CCS 中运行代码
  6. 代码运行后,确认操作正确。
    1. 通过测量接头 (J18) 和示波器之间的连接产生的波形来检查输出电压。为了更清楚地了解引脚位置,请查看原理图或图 3-1
    2. 通过检查 EVM 上的 LED 来确定使能和中断的正确操作。请参阅表 3-1 中的 LED 功能。
    3. 通过按住 MSP430 LaunchPad 上的按钮 S1,序列发生器将按顺序使电压轨断电。松开按钮会使电源轨按顺序上电。可通过将示波器连接到接头 J18 的使能输出来检查上电和断电序列。
    4. 图 5-5 展示了上电序列中前三个使能信号的正确操作以及来自 TPS389006 的相应同步脉冲。
      GUID-DB769625-7F7B-4906-993C-421F7D600568-low.png图 4-5 具有同步的上电序列
    5. 图 5-6 展示了断电序列中前三个使能信号的正确操作以及来自 TPS389006 的相应同步脉冲。
      GUID-157BEAE4-FBB4-458A-9BC4-C2D34BB86FF9-low.png图 4-6 具有同步的断电序列
    6. 图 5-7 展示了在 EVM 上放置示波器探头以查看同步信号的位置。将探头放置在最靠近器件 U2 的 R30 端子上。
      GUID-0145A0B9-519D-4C52-AAF7-FD4562916259-low.jpg图 4-7 同步信号探头
  7. DIP 开关也可用于手动测试器件中断和使能的功能。
    1. 如果发生中断,则 LED1 (D1) 会亮起。可以使用控制 TPS389006 电源轨的 DIP 开关 (SW1) 对此进行测试。当这些 DIP 开关切换到关闭位置时,相应的电源轨被手动关闭,从而产生中断并点亮 LED1。
    2. 激活使能 1 后,LED2 (D2) 亮起。可以使用控制 TPS38700S-Q1 使能的 DIP 开关 (SW2) 对此进行测试。当这些 DIP 开关切换到关闭位置时,相应的 EN 被手动关闭,从而使 LED2 熄灭。
    3. 当使能 2 和使能 3 被激活时,LED3 (D3) 和 LED4 (D4) 分别亮起。可以通过与 LED2 相同的方式对此进行验证。